When I first started my graduate education, I was attracted to the framework of Abrahamic Religions or the idea that Jews, Christians and Muslims should return back to their founder, Abraham, to better understand their faiths and move beyond contemporary differences.  In the last several years, I have been traveling to Southeast Asia as the director of the Barzinji Institute for Global Virtual Learning at Shenandoah University.  Through my travels, I have seen the power and influence of Islam in the region and how it interacts with other religions such as Hinduism and Buddhism.  I sit down with one of the foremost experts in Islam in Southeast Asia, Khairudin Aljunied, to better understand the region and Islam’s relationship with other faiths.

Dr. Khairudin Aljunied (PhD SOAS, London) is a Professor of Islam in Southeast Asia at the International Institute of Islamic Thought and Civilization (ISTAC-IIUM).

He is concurrently a Senior Fellow (formerly and Professor as well as Malaysia Chair of Islam in Southeast Asia at the Alwaleed Centre for Muslim-Christian Understanding, Georgetown University).

He has held visiting full professorships at Columbia University, USA (Fulbright Program) in 2013, University of Brunei Darussalam in 2021-2022 and the University of Malaya in 2022-2023.
